Inubiki had been rather surprised when Kouga found out about the five ofuda plastered across her form. Yes, he was upset – after all this put a damper on his plans to have her accept her demonic heritage, something she did not know about – but he understood that there was nothing either of them could do about it now.

He held his temper in check that day, treating her as he always did – if only a tad more gentle in instructing her in hunting. And the more time went on, the closer their friendship became.

~*~*~*~*~*~*~*~*~*~*~*~*~*~

Soon, growled his blood beast, another decade later. It’s too bad that that idiotic priest slowed her maturation. She should be in the Den now with--

I’m well aware of this, he responded to and effectively cut off his blood beast, just as annoyed – which wasn’t unusual, considering that they were truly one creature. The only difference between them being that he was ‘Civilized’ {a fact that the Inu Clan’s heir was quick to deny and contest} his beast was the voice of his baser instincts. Taking a deep breath, inhaling the scents of the forest, he calmed himself while trying to calm his beast as well.

“What’s on your mind, Boss?” came the voice of one of his ‘henchmen’, Ginta.

“Yeah, Boss, you’ve been rather distracted lately,” added Hakkaku; the pair exchanging worried gazes before turning to regard the wolf prince. Kouga’s excursions to the Inu-Ookami border were well known, and he usually came back with the scent of a female surrounding him had become expected. The only part his pack questioned was why he left the female wherever it was that she resided.

Kouga turned his head to regard the pair in annoyance before he sighed, looking back into the forest. “My beast is becoming more insistent. And impatient.”

The pair turned to look at each other questioningly, before looking back to Kouga.

“Then just take her” Ginta said.

“Yeah, Boss – You’ve obviously been courting her. You know the pack wouldn’t care if she’s human.” Hakkaku chimed in. “It’s been 10 full seasons since you met her – if you wait much longer, you won’t be able to take her.”

Kouga growled lightly. “It’s complicated.” She’s not human! He ignored his beast’s roaring in his mind.

“How?” the duo questioned in stereo.

Kouga closed his eyes, frowning, before looking at the pair in irritation. “…She is the ward of an aging houshi.” He shook his head before he started walking back towards the Den, deciding to speak to his father about the situation. “She won’t leave him.”

The pair blinked and followed. “She’s miko?” Ginta asked.

Kouga didn’t answer, and they took that as being dismissed – or ignored – so they wandered off, shaking their heads. “With the way he is, the only way he’s gonna get a mate is if he doesn’t give her a choice.” Hakkaku whispered to his pack-brother.

Kouga heard and winced, but only mentally – refusing to allow his pack-mates to see that the comment had struck. Hard.

~*~*~*~*~*~*~*~*~*~*~*~*~*~

About 150-some odd years later…

Kouga turned his head, the sound of his wolves calling for help reaching his ears. “…..?” With a scowl he turned and bolted as fast as he could towards his feeding pack.

Upon arriving, he let his gaze scan the area, finding several of his mortal wolves slain.

“You bastards…” Kouga demanded, refusing to show the shock he felt at the hanyou before him. While the hanyou was male, he was like a ghost from the past. “Why did you kill my henchmen?”

“Inuyasha, be careful of that guy…” the female to the hanyou’s right said, but said hanyou ignored her.

“So you’re the head of these man-eaters!?” The hanyou demanded.

That hair...! Those ears…! His beast snarled, struggling to break free to take vengeance for the wrong done – not just the dead wolves lying around him, but from ages ago. “So What?” He asked, crossing his arms over his chest, keeping his tone calm but was unable to bite back his annoyance. “You killed my wolves, I won’t forgive you!”

“Shut Up!” The hanyou responded, taking a step forward, an arm raise with claws bared while the other arm was stretched out but partially lowered to his side. “Making this strong scent of human blood – Just how many have you killed?!”

Kouga scowled, at least she was intelligent. He hated giving her any compliment, but this male hanyou was a complete idiot in his eyes. “I was letting them have their lunch.” He narrowed his eyes. “Do you have a problem with that, you dogface?”

The hanyou pulled back, looking aghast. “What...! ‘Dogface’!?”

Kouga continued to look calm but irritated. “I hate the smell of Dogs!” Finally he lost his temper. “It Makes Me Sick!”

“Interesting. Then I’ll slaughter you so you don’t have to be sick!” The hanyou retorted as he smirked at Kouga as the wolf lost his temper. As the hanyou lunged, he unsheathed his sword – surprising the wolf prince as the banged up old blade transformed into a rather obscenely huge sword – using Kouga as his target of a downward swing of the blade.

Just before the blade made contact Kouga leapt backwards; the sword contacting with the ground made a bit of a ‘Ching’ sound, hardened steel upon unyielding stone. Without even landing, Kouga lunged back towards the hanyou that dared to look like her. That wench... The traitorous bitch…

Just thinking about her pissed him off even more.

Using the power of the Shikon shards in his legs, Kouga spun in the air to pick up speed, then burst from the ‘tornado’ he’d created, lunging at the hanyou. When he contacted with the ground, he crouched and swung his leg into the air – a back kick aimed for the hanyou’s cheek. It connected, sending the hanyou flying backwards to skid across the dirt on his back.

“How…?” The human in black and blue robes and carrying a staff of some kind said in astonishment.

“He’s Fast…” Agreed the female carrying a rather large boomerang. A weapon that smelled of youkai bones.

It was then that the indecently dressed female caught Kouga’s attention. “Inuyasha! Be careful! That guy is equipped with Shikon Shards on his right hand and both legs!”

Kouga stopped and turned to look over his shoulder with a stunned gaze and a startled sound escaping him. He met the indecent female’s gaze, unable to comprehend for a moment what had occurred.

“Damn. Why didn’t you tell me sooner?!” The downed hanyou demanded, before adding in an amused tone “So that’s it. You had a big attitude, because you were using the power of the Shikon shards.”

Kouga humphed, and retorted with “Stop crying while you’re rolling on the ground.”

“And you can only get this strong using the power of the Shikon?”

“You bastard - Shut up, you dogface!”

“Don’t be ridiculous, you wimpy wolf!”

The group on the sidelines watched in a mixture of apprehension and disbelief. "Both sides are very stubborn...” the monk observed, but Kouga tuned anything else from them out – only the female in green had any level of his attention.

“I am the prince of the Orozouko tribe, Kouga. Remember that!” he exclaimed before lunging once again at the hanyou – throwing several punches and a couple of kicks that the irritating dog managed to dodge. Barely.

Kouga was aware that the half-breed’s neko had transformed and scared off his wolves – another irritant for him to file away with inu hanyou in his mind. He managed to land one or two attacks, but the hanyou managed to hold his own, throwing Kouga into a shed where the prince landed in a kneeling position.

“So, all you can do is dodge my attacks...” He ignored the thoughtful expression on the hanyou’s face and lunged, smirking, running full speed at the hanyou. He couldn’t kill the female hanyou that betrayed him, but this one smelled like her. He was just as good.

When the hanyou lifted his sword, preparing to attack, Kouga’s senses went on full alert, bringing his head up and his beast to the fore in warning. “Danger!!” His beast said in his voice, as it took control long enough to stop his forward progress and hurl him back and upwards away from the attack.

“Heh?” Came the hanyou’s confused voice as Kouga landed on the roof of a hut several yards away.

To his wolves, Kouga ordered “Retreat! Something is wrong! I feel something Dangerous!” And as quick as the words left his mouth, he bolted out of the village, leaving a rather stunned pack of humans and hanyou.

He ran for several miles, coming to a stop at the sight of the battlefield where the sight of that hanyou had brought his attention to. As he came to a stop on the edge, he slowly walked into the battlefield-turned-burial ground until he came to the stone where his pack’s last Alpha – his father – was buried.

Stopping by the stone that marked the grave, his gaze lost focus for a moment as he thought back upon the day that would be burned in his memory forever.

The day she betrayed him.

The day he swore to never associate with the haughty Inu Clan ever again – even if she knew nothing of her demonic kin.

= Flashback =

It had been that same day that he’d sought out his father to ask him what to do about his female-troubles that everything had changed.

Just as the sun had started its downward decent, the Birds of Paradise had attacked the ookami training grounds – injuring several of the young members of the pack, and turning Kouga’s uncle into an afternoon snack.

When he’d heard the screams, he and the rest of the warriors had gone running to their comrade’s aid – even many of the females had gone.

When he arrived at the training grounds, he had to push his shock away, but was only able to until the Chief of the birds came into his vision – holding a struggling ‘Biki in its ‘human’ arms. “Well, well, well!” exclaimed the bird at the horrified look on Kouga’s face, one hand over the hanyou’s mouth.

“Put her down!” Kouga demanded, his attention being drawn to the side by one of his fallen, but dying, comrades.

“Just … kill… them…” Lord Katsuyo said weakly.

“…!” Kouga looked at his comrade – Lord Katsuyo!! “Father.. How?!”

“That ..wench.. *cough*….She led them here…”

Kouga was dumbfounded. ‘Biki…HIS ‘Biki … was the reason his pack was attacked?! The reason his pack was being slaughtered?!

He turned his attention back to the Bird who seemed content to listen, though he was surprised when it cried out and threw the female down to the ground where she hit and bounced off Lord Katsuyo. The dying lord let out a grunt and a weak growl at the female.

Kouga turned and started to run to the hanyou’s side while the bird growled out “Stupid bitch!” Apparently his woman had bitten the hand that covered her mouth, but Kouga was drawn up short when the bird continued. “Can’t be loyal to anything!” it laughed.

Kouga’s blood ran cold as he watched the woman pushing herself up slowly, the sound of battle all around him. “What do you mean?” he didn’t want to hear what the bird was saying, especially with that look ‘Biki was giving him.

She looked horrified at the situation, but it was marred by the smell of guilt radiating off her form. She HAD led them here… “WHY?!” He demanded of her, causing her to flinch.

“We just asked if she could bring us here,” crowed the chief of the birds of paradise. “She was more then happy to lead us.”

The look of horror on ‘Biki’s face slowly found itself ignored by the wolf as realization dawned– how ever errant it was. She’d Done It! His father was dieing because of HER!

“Don’t listen to him, Kouga-sama!” She tried to plead with him. “He told me you were comrades! I didn’t know!” He was seeing red, her pleas went unanswered. Her unshed tears went ignored.

First things first – either destroy the Birds, or get them on the run!

“If you leave before I’m done here, I will kill you.” He vowed to the hanyou female, before turning and attacking the chief of the birds.

~*~*~*~*~*~*~*~*~*~*~*~

The battle had lasted not long after that, honestly, but many of his pack – many of his pack’s FEMALES had been lost – before the Birds of Paradise fled back to their own mountain peaks.

By this time though, his father had passed on, and Kouga found the betrayer holding his father’s head in her lap.

“Get away from him!” He snarled and rushed her, causing her to cry out and back away quickly. Grabbing the female by the cloth of her top near her neck, he growled loudly at her. “Why?! Why did you bring them here?!” he demanded again.

The female’s scent of fear only seemed to cement her guilt in his mind. She’d already admitted she brought them to the training grounds. “I didn’t know you were enemies!” She responded, struggling in his grasp. Her protector for the last decade had turned into her attacker, and with the ofuda binding her, she had no means to truly protect herself against him.

He brought his face close to hers and snarled, his eyes bleeding red. “Bull shit. Everyone knows that my tribe and theirs are enemies!” He snarled, forgetting that the female trapped in his claws had been raised by a priest and did not know much of the issues between demon clans.

Closing his eyes for a moment, he forced himself to calm. Turning around, he brought the female with him. “Look! Look at what you’ve done!” He snarled, holding her by her upper arm in a bruising grip while he pointed with his other hand. The survivors were moving through the field, trying to collect the barely living while others collected their dead.

Her eyes filled with tears at the scene before her, her ears pinning back against her head. “I didn’t know!” She said again, her voice breaking in a sob. Why wouldn’t he believe her?!

Turning back to her, he ignored her tears and snarled down into her face. “You have betrayed me, ‘Biki. But for the sake of the last ten years,” he closed his eyes and took a calming breath. He would not start as alpha by spilling the blood of a female – no matter her wrongs. “Get lost. Get off my land.” He opened his blood tinged eyes. “If I ever see you on orouzoko land again, I will kill you.” his beast and he vowed together.

He held her tightly by her upper arm, letting his promise sink in to her brain; watching as her skin paled almost to match her hair color, before he pushed her away from him.

She turned and fled to the trees, heading in the direction of the shrine several miles away. When she paused on the edge of the tree line to look back at him, several members of his tribe snarled at her, several of the nearby wolves snapped at her ankles.

Hakkaku and Ginta looked around at the devastation, pain in their hearts. Ginta’s litter-mate, his sister had been killed in this battle, and yet he looked at Hakkaku and silently wondered if maybe Kouga was over reacting.

Hakkaku shook his head to remain silent. If they knew Kouga, he would cool off and eventually go after the female.

“He wants her. That’s why he reacted like this.” Kouga heard Hakkaku whisper to Ginta. He ignored them both.

They were right in only that he wanted her – but he would never forgive her. He would not go after her, ever. And he would keep his promise… if he ever saw her again..

She would die.

= End Flashback =
